Nietzsche e la "Carmen" di Bizet
"La musica non è un’arte ma una categoria dello spirito umano", scriveva Friedrich Wilhelm Nietzsche (1844-1900), filosofo, aforista, saggista, poeta, compositore, accademico e filologo tedesco.
Tra i massimi filosofi di ogni tempo, Friedrich Nietzsche ebbe un'influenza controversa e indiscutibile sul pensiero filosofico, letterario e politico del Novecento. La sua filosofia è considerata da alcuni uno spartiacque fra la filosofia tradizionale ed un nuovo modello di riflessione, informale e provocatoria.

Osamu Obi, 1965 | Figurative/Portrait painter
Japanese painter⏭ 小尾 修 Osamu Obi was born in Kanagawa, Japan.
- 1988 - Graduated from Musashino Art University, Department of Oil Painting;
- 1990 - Completed Master's Degree Program in Oil Painting, Musashino Art University;
- 1991 - Exhibition of Grand Prize Paintings, Tokyo Central Museum. Awarded Grand Prize;
- 1993 - Participated in Yasui Prize Exhibition;
- 1996 - Participated in Exchange Exhibition between South Korean and Japanese Oil Painters (Yokohama and Seoul).
Henri-Joseph Harpignies | The Barbizon school of painters
Harpignies, Henri-Joseph (born June 28, 1819, Valenciennes, France-died Aug. 28, 1916, Saint-Prive), French landscape painter, born at Valenciennes in 1819, was intended by his parents for a business career, but his determination to become an artist was so strong that it conquered all obstacles, and he was allowed at the age of twenty-seven to enter Achard's atelier in Paris.
From this painter he acquired a groundwork of sound constructive draughtsmanship, which is so marked a feature of his landscape painting.
